I have read and reread all these comments, etc and still am lost on what to do.

I have a 14 SGS with Rockford PBR300x2 Amp and I have the Polk Marine speakers.

Should I have harley flash it for a flat line EQ curve or what do I tell them? I called and asked them about it and they seemed all confused. Or do I have no flash at all?

Whats the final consensus?

According to rockfords website have them flash the system to 8 speakers, 2 amps, but under the amp tab of the system for amp 1&2 select no. I believe this is because those settings are specifically for the boom amps, and you selecting the 8 speakers 2 amps option so it enables all speaker line outputs from the radio with a flat eq curve, at least that's whT I'm getting from this document, and it seems to be inline with j@m, and soundz and many others who deal with harley sound systems.
